หากต้องการบันทึกไฟล์ คุณต้องอยู่ในโหมดคำสั่งก่อน กด Esc เพื่อเข้าสู่โหมดคำสั่ง แล้วพิมพ์ :wq เพื่อเขียนและออกจากไฟล์ อีกตัวเลือกหนึ่งที่เร็วกว่าคือการใช้แป้นพิมพ์ลัด ZZ เพื่อเขียนและออก สำหรับ non-vi ที่เริ่มต้น การเขียนหมายถึงการบันทึก และ quit หมายถึงการออก vi
ฉันจะบันทึกใน Linux ได้อย่างไร
เมื่อคุณแก้ไขไฟล์แล้ว ให้กด [Esc] เปลี่ยนเป็นโหมดคำสั่ง แล้วกด :w แล้วกด [Enter] ดังที่แสดงด้านล่าง หากต้องการบันทึกไฟล์และออกพร้อมกัน คุณสามารถใช้ ESC และ ที่สำคัญและกด [Enter] หรือ กด [Esc] แล้วพิมพ์ Shift + ZZ เพื่อบันทึกและออกจากไฟล์
ฉันจะบันทึกไฟล์ใน Vim ได้อย่างไร
คำสั่งบันทึกการเปลี่ยนแปลงใน vim
- เริ่มกลุ่มโดยพิมพ์ชื่อไฟล์ vim
- ในการแทรกข้อความกด i
- ตอนนี้เริ่มแก้ไขข้อความ เพิ่มข้อความใหม่หรือลบข้อความที่ไม่ต้องการ
- กดปุ่ม Esc แล้วพิมพ์ :w เพื่อบันทึกไฟล์เป็นกลุ่ม
- หนึ่งสามารถกด Esc และพิมพ์ :wq เพื่อบันทึกการเปลี่ยนแปลงไปยังไฟล์และออกจากกลุ่ม
- อีกทางเลือกหนึ่งคือกด :x
คุณจะบันทึกไฟล์ใน Unix ได้อย่างไร?
อย่าลืมใช้ คำสั่งบันทึก บ่อยครั้งเมื่อแก้ไขเอกสารสำคัญ
...
กล้า
:w | บันทึกการเปลี่ยนแปลง (เช่น เขียน) ลงในไฟล์ของคุณ |
---|---|
:wq หรือ ZZ | บันทึกการเปลี่ยนแปลงไปยังไฟล์แล้ว qui |
::! cmd | รันคำสั่งเดียว (cmd) และกลับไปที่vi |
:NS | เริ่มต้นเชลล์ UNIX ใหม่ – เพื่อกลับไปยัง Vi จากเชลล์ ให้พิมพ์ exit หรือ Ctrl-d |
ฉันจะบันทึกและค้นหาในโปรแกรมแก้ไข vi ได้อย่างไร
คำสั่งบันทึกเนื้อหาของเอดิเตอร์คือ :w คุณสามารถรวมคำสั่งข้างต้นกับคำสั่ง quit หรือใช้ :wq และ return วิธีที่ง่ายที่สุดในการบันทึกการเปลี่ยนแปลงและออกจาก vi คือกับ คำสั่ง ZZ. เมื่อคุณอยู่ในโหมดคำสั่ง ให้พิมพ์ ZZ
คุณจะสร้างไฟล์ใน Linux ได้อย่างไร?
วิธีสร้างไฟล์ข้อความบน Linux:
- การใช้การสัมผัสเพื่อสร้างไฟล์ข้อความ: $ touch NewFile.txt
- การใช้ cat เพื่อสร้างไฟล์ใหม่: $ cat NewFile.txt …
- เพียงใช้ > เพื่อสร้างไฟล์ข้อความ: $ > NewFile.txt
- สุดท้ายนี้ เราสามารถใช้ชื่อโปรแกรมแก้ไขข้อความ แล้วสร้างไฟล์ เช่น:
สร้างและบันทึกไฟล์ใน Linux ได้อย่างไร?
ในการสร้างไฟล์ใหม่ให้รันคำสั่ง cat ตามด้วยตัวดำเนินการเปลี่ยนเส้นทาง > และชื่อไฟล์ที่คุณต้องการสร้าง กด Enter พิมพ์ข้อความและเมื่อคุณทำเสร็จแล้วให้กด CRTL+D เพื่อบันทึกไฟล์
ฉันจะบันทึกและแก้ไขไฟล์ใน Linux ได้อย่างไร
หากต้องการบันทึกไฟล์ คุณต้องอยู่ในโหมดคำสั่งก่อน กด Esc เพื่อเข้าสู่โหมดคำสั่ง จากนั้นกด พิมพ์ :wq ถึง เขียนและออกจากไฟล์
...
ทรัพยากร Linux เพิ่มเติม
คำสั่ง | จุดมุ่งหมาย |
---|---|
$ vi | เปิดหรือแก้ไขไฟล์ |
i | สลับไปที่โหมดแทรก |
Esc | สลับไปที่โหมดคำสั่ง |
:w | บันทึกและแก้ไขต่อ |
ฉันจะเรียกใช้ไฟล์ vim ได้อย่างไร
มันค่อนข้างง่าย:
- เปิดไฟล์ใหม่หรือไฟล์ที่มีอยู่ด้วย vim filename
- พิมพ์ i เพื่อเปลี่ยนเป็นโหมดแทรกเพื่อให้คุณสามารถเริ่มแก้ไขไฟล์ได้
- ป้อนหรือแก้ไขข้อความด้วยไฟล์ของคุณ
- เมื่อเสร็จแล้ว ให้กดแป้น Escape Esc เพื่อออกจากโหมดแทรกและกลับสู่โหมดคำสั่ง
- พิมพ์ :wq เพื่อบันทึกและออกจากไฟล์
ไฟล์ VIM ถูกบันทึกไว้ที่ไหน?
ดังที่คนอื่นกล่าวไว้: โดยค่าเริ่มต้นจะบันทึกในไดเร็กทอรีที่คุณเริ่มต้น แต่ถ้าคุณไม่ทราบว่าคุณเริ่มต้นไดเรกทอรีใด วิธีค้นหาคือใช้:pwd com ใน vim. สิ่งนี้จะส่งออกไดเร็กทอรีปัจจุบัน นั่นคือสิ่งที่ vim จะจัดเก็บไฟล์
ฉันจะย้ายไฟล์ใน Linux ได้อย่างไร
นี่คือวิธีการ:
- เปิดตัวจัดการไฟล์ Nautilus
- ค้นหาไฟล์ที่คุณต้องการย้ายและคลิกขวาที่ไฟล์ดังกล่าว
- จากเมนูป๊อปอัป (รูปที่ 1) ให้เลือกตัวเลือก "ย้ายไปที่"
- เมื่อหน้าต่าง Select Destination เปิดขึ้น ให้ไปที่ตำแหน่งใหม่สำหรับไฟล์
- เมื่อคุณพบโฟลเดอร์ปลายทางแล้ว ให้คลิกเลือก
ฉันจะค้นหาไฟล์ใน vi ได้อย่างไร
ในการค้นหาสตริงอักขระ พิมพ์ / ติดตาม ตามสตริงที่คุณต้องการค้นหา แล้วกด Return vi วางตำแหน่งเคอร์เซอร์เมื่อเกิดเหตุการณ์ถัดไปของสตริง ตัวอย่างเช่น หากต้องการค้นหาสตริง "meta" ให้พิมพ์ /meta ตามด้วย Return พิมพ์ n เพื่อไปยังรายการถัดไปของสตริง
สองโหมดของ vi คืออะไร?
สองโหมดการทำงานใน vi คือ โหมดเข้าและโหมดคำสั่ง.
คำสั่งให้ตัดทั้งบรรทัดคืออะไร?
นอกจากนี้คุณยังสามารถฆ่าทั้งสายด้วย C-SHIFT-DEL. คำสั่งเหล่านี้ไม่สมมาตรเท่าคำสั่งสำหรับการย้ายเคอร์เซอร์ พวกเขาเป็นเหมือนกริยาที่ผิดปกติในไวยากรณ์ของ Emacs